Taste of Cherry

1997 · Movie · 99 min · ★ 7.7 · 81% critics

Drama

A man drives through Tehran and the surrounding hills with a single, unsettling request: he wants to hire someone to carry out a final favor after he’s gone. As he picks up strangers and offers money, each conversation turns into a tense, intimate debate about faith, duty, and the value of staying alive.

About

You’ll likely connect with this if you enjoy quiet, philosophical stories that linger on moral questions and leave room for interpretation, like Close-Up or Ten; Not for you if you need fast pacing, clear answers, or lighter subject matter.

Pros: thought-provoking conversations; haunting existential mood; memorable final stretch | Cons: very slow pace; repetitive car scenes; distant main character
